The Production and Product Development Assistant will support the design and production teams by helping manage the development of new products, coordinating sampling and manufacturing processes, and ensuring smooth day-to-day operations.
This is a varied role that requires strong organisational, communication, and problem-solving skills.
Key Responsibilities
Product Development Support:
- Assist in researching customer needs and supporting the generation of new product ideas.
- Support the sourcing of materials, components, packaging, and suppliers.
- Help create and maintain detailed product specifications and sample feedback documentation.
Sample Management:
- Assist in managing jewellery and homeware samples with suppliers and internal teams.
- Help collate and provide feedback on samples in a timely and structured manner.
- Work with manufacturers, and suppliers to ensure smooth and timely product development, and bulk production.
Production Support:
- Help to manage production timelines, monitor quality control, and assist with the launch of new products.
- Track and manage inventory levels of raw materials and finished goods.
- Create and update product specifications
- Create and manage products on zedonk keeping them up to date ensuring the bill of materials and costs remain accurate.
Organise trials and testing:
- Assist with product testing, including co-ordinating with third party testing and wear testing.
Packaging Inventory Management & Development:
- Manage packaging stock and assist in developing new packaging.
Quality Control:
- Inspect shipments for quality.
- Cross-check purchase orders and invoices and resolve any discrepancies.
- Oversee the repairs process and maintain accurate records of repaired items.
Shipping & Logistics Support:
- Track shipments, liaise with suppliers, and resolve delays
- Coordinate raw material and finished goods shipments.
- Ensure cost-effective logistics solutions.
- Book incoming and outgoing shipments into Zedonk
